(https://www.video-bookmark.com/bookmark/6671634/dry-star-restoration/)If there's a fire, smoke makes sure to comply with. While the fire's smoke is composed of aspects that make your home unsafe to be in, the damage smoke leaves behind doesn't quit there. Smoke will certainly float to apparently every component of your home, sticking to furnishings, design, curtains, walls, ceilings, floors, and a lot more.
The water will saturate into the charred materials and infected various other areas of the home untouched by the fire. If left unattended or missed out on during fire damage repair, the water damage will just get worse with time and can cause mold growth, safety and security issues for your home's structure, and unattractive looks around your area, including deformed flooring, peeling paint, and visible stains.

Water reduction is commonly the very first step of the fire, smoke, and water damages restoration process after a damage control has been completed. This resolves the water damage head-on and consists of steps to stop further issues for your room prior to, throughout, and after reconstruction. Inspection and damage control to assess the level of water damageIsolation of water damage to affected areas to restrict water from infecting dry areasInspection of your home's foundation for structural stabilityExtraction of any type of standing water from the propertyStructural drying with commercial-grade equipmentSite clean-up that will certainly clear away debris, pack out salvageable content for remediation, and make method for repair servicesWe'll likewise complete added damages reduction by boarding up damaged doors and windows, applying tarps to holes in roofing systems, and completing other actions to avoid added damages and risks to your home while the repair services are happening.
